Dental implants have revolutionized restorative dentistry, offering a dependable answer for people who've misplaced teeth. While they provide quite a few advantages, together with improved aesthetics and performance, some sufferers report experiencing headaches after the process. This raises an necessary question: can dental implants cause headaches?
Understanding the mechanics of dental implants is crucial. They encompass three main parts: a titanium publish that serves as a root, an abutment that connects the publish to the crown, and the crown itself that mimics the natural tooth. The placement of these components requires surgical intervention, which inherently carries risks and potential side effects.

Headaches following dental implant surgery could arise because of a quantity of factors. One common cause is the trauma related to the surgical process. The complexity of implant insertion can result in inflammation and irritation within the surrounding tissues, which can, in flip, trigger headache symptoms. This inflammation typically subsides over time, and headaches usually diminish as therapeutic progresses.

If the implant alters the patient’s bite or jaw alignment, it may pressure the muscles and joints responsible for jaw motion. This strain can lead to muscle tension and, subsequently, tension-type headaches. Examining jaw alignment is crucial for sufferers reporting ongoing headaches post-implantation.


Nerve irritation might also contribute to headaches following dental implant surgery. Should the surgical procedure inadvertently irritate nearby nerves, sufferers would possibly experience pain that radiates to other areas of the top. Such neuropathic pain could be challenging to diagnose, because it doesn't at all times correlate with visible dental problems.

Stress and nervousness surrounding dental procedures can't be ignored. Many people expertise dental nervousness, which can lead to muscle pressure in the neck and shoulders, often resulting in headaches. For those already feeling apprehensive about getting implants, the stress of the surgery itself might exacerbate pre-existing headache conditions.

It can additionally be essential to think about the impression of post-operative drugs. Pain management after dental implant surgery usually includes analgesics, which might have unwanted effects, together with headaches. Opioids, in particular, can disrupt normal sleep patterns, resulting in tension headaches upon waking. Hydration performs a significant role in recovery. Some sufferers may neglect to maintain correct fluid consumption post-surgery, resulting in dehydration, which is a known headache trigger. Ensuring proper hydration not solely aids in recovery but may also mitigate headache occurrences.

Identifying the sort of headache is important for understanding its cause in relation to dental implants. Tension headaches, believed to stem from muscle strain and pressure, could be exacerbated by poor posture through the recovery phase. On the opposite hand, migraine triggers may be multifactorial, and dental procedures, involving important discomfort and stress, may affect their onset.


Consultation with a dental skilled is vital for anyone suffering from ongoing headaches after dental implant surgery. A thorough examination can provide insights into alignment points, nerve irritation, or different complications linked to the implants.   • Dental implants could result in headaches if they are improperly aligned, inflicting pressure in jaw muscular tissues throughout chewing.

  • Some sufferers experience headaches as a end result of modifications in chunk alignment following the placement of dental implants.

  • Nerve irritation during the implant procedure can create radiating pain, which might manifest as headaches post-surgery.

  • Allergic reactions to the supplies utilized in dental implants have been reported, doubtlessly leading to systemic symptoms together with headaches.

  • Sinus pressure or infection, particularly in upper jaw implants, can contribute to headache development because of proximity to sinus cavities.

  • Tension headaches may arise from altered facial structure or elevated stress on surrounding teeth and gums after implant placement.

  • Psychological factors, such as anxiousness in regards to the process or recovery course of, also can play a role within the onset of headaches.

  • Habitual grinding or clenching of teeth due to the international presence of implants might improve muscle tension, leading to frequent headaches.
